Practice Studio: the workroom and store offering a sustainable fashion experience
June 24, 2021 | Eliza WoodsSimply calling Practice Studio a boutique clothing store in the heart of Fortitude Valley really wouldn’t do it justice. The store not only offers customers a chance to browse and purchase pieces from emerging designers, it also doubles as a workroom where old clothes can be reimagined and custom creations can be made.
